When the drama started, it was obvious that there are gonna be cute cliche moments, but that 100% fine with me cuz that's what I was looking for. What threw me off was around halfway through the show, the girl MC was just not growing with the pace of the story. it was like I was just waiting for her to get on the same pace as the rest of the characters. I saw a lot of people giving this a 9-10 rating, so I am definitely the odd man out. I really loved how the story was going, but it just started to go downhill even though there were some plot twists.
I have seen a few girl-dressing-as-a-guy dramas, and this follows a similar story line in terms of the girl trying her best to hide it and someone finds out.
Let me tell you, Song Joongki's character carried the show for me. I was hooked onto what he was going to do next. That was one of the reasons I did not drop the drama.
